Universiti Teknologi Malaysia Institutional Repository

Distributed 68HC11 microcontroller using SJA 1000AS controller area network

Rahmat, Normala (2009) Distributed 68HC11 microcontroller using SJA 1000AS controller area network. Masters thesis, Universiti Teknologi Malaysia, Faculty of Electrical Engineering.

[img]
Preview
PDF
324kB

Abstract

Distributed embedded system can be used for wider area application with many joint-functionalities among multiple controllers compared to using a single controller system. Originally developed for automotive purpose, Controller Area Network (CAN) protocol promises advantages in sending small data bytes over the network for distributed embedded system applications. Hence, this project revolves around the development of a dependable distributed embedded system, which suggest the usage of CAN protocol as a dependable networking solution. Researches had been made to find out the suitable CAN chip to build up the CAN bus system. As a result an SJA 1000 Stand Alone Can Controller was used to make three chip of microcontrollers to communicate with each other without using a personal computer as the host computer in the serial interface mode. The type of the microcontroller chosen was MC68HC11A8 as one of the M68HC1 IE Family by Motorola. The scope of work for this project was to find out the suitable instructions for MC68HC11A8 microcontroller especially the I/O configuration to conduct the communication process through the CAN controller between the three MC68HC11A8 chips . The Micro C - IDE was used to write down the program while the 68HC11 simulator was also used to simulate and translate the program. The simulated program was then downloaded into the Proteus Program (schematic circuit layout program). Research for the suitable protocol of the CAN bus which is BasicCAN protocol as the interface to MC68HC11A8 chip was also being done. For this project, it involved three MC68HC11A8 chips, three SJAlOOO/n Stand Alone Can Controller as their interface, three 82C520 chips as a driver for SJA 1000/n and also 68HC11 simulator. At the end of this project, demonstrator had been successfully developed, performing simple application that imitates communication over the network. As such, the CAN protocol can be fully utilized in the development of an application specific dependable networking system by using PeliCAN protocol} for future work.

Item Type:Thesis (Masters)
Additional Information:Supervisors : Dr Muhammad Nasir Ibrahim, Dr Mariani Idroas; Thesis (Sarjana Kejuruteraan (Elektrik - Elektronik dan Telekomunikasi)) - Universiti Teknologi Malaysia, 2009
Uncontrolled Keywords:embedded computer systems, microcontrollers
Subjects:T Technology > TK Electrical engineering. Electronics Nuclear engineering
Divisions:Electrical Engineering
ID Code:18257
Deposited By: Kamariah Mohamed Jong
Deposited On:18 Mar 2014 04:41
Last Modified:18 Sep 2017 11:49

Repository Staff Only: item control page